When considering the installation of a garage door, understanding the space requirements is essential. How a lot room do I want to put in a garage door? This query encompasses numerous elements, together with the size of the door, the sort of opening mechanism, and native constructing codes. Each of those components performs a major function in determining the adequate space necessary for a practical and environment friendly garage door.


First, contemplate the dimensions of the garage door itself. Standard garage doorways usually are available in various widths and heights. Common sizes are around 7 to eight toes in peak and 8 to 10 feet in width for a single-door configuration. Double doors, catering to two-car garages, may be around 12 to 16 toes extensive. It's essential to measure the opening accurately to ensure a correct match.

Next, the sort of garage door and its opening mechanism also decide the required house for installation. For occasion, an overhead garage door sometimes requires further headroom at the high, typically round 12 inches above the door opening. This area is important for the track that will maintain the door when it's opened.

Furthermore, the type of materials used for the door can even affect installation. Steel, wood, and fiberglass all have distinct weights and properties that may require additional reinforcement in your garage frame. Always factor in the weight of the door when planning the installation. Heavier doors necessitate extra sturdy hardware and doubtlessly a stronger body, impacting total house necessities.


A crucial facet of installation includes considering the ceiling height of your garage. Low ceilings can restrict the types of doors that may be installed successfully. If the ceiling top is lower than 8 feet, you may face challenges when attempting to put in normal doors that require greater headroom. Understanding how your ceiling configuration affects the house obtainable will save you time and potential frustration.


Another consideration is the floor area contained in the garage. When the garage door opens, it'll create a path that needs to be clear for safe accessibility. Objects such as storage items, automobiles, and tools mustn't hinder the door's path. Planning your garage layout when determining house for the model new door can improve both functionality and security.

  • Measure the whole width and peak of the garage door to ensure a correct match within the available house.

  • Consider further clearance above the door for the tracks and any safety options that could be required.

  • Account for aspect clearance to accommodate the door's operation as well as any home windows or shelving near the opening.

  • Allow for a minimum of 6 inches on either side of the door to facilitate installation and maintenance entry.

  • Ensure a minimal of 12 to 18 inches of headroom for the door's hardware and track system, which is crucial for easy operation.

  • Evaluate the depth of the garage to substantiate that there's enough space for the door to open properly with out obstruction.

  • Factor within the location of any electrical retailers or light fixtures that might intrude with the door’s motion.

  • Assess the encircling panorama, such as slopes or bushes, which may impression area availability as soon as the door is put in.

  • Consider the type of door being installed, as completely different styles (like sectional or roll-up doors) could require varying quantities of space.

What facet clearance is necessary for a garage door?undefinedFor a regular garage door, you must have a minimal of 3-4 inches of aspect clearance from the wall to the door. This ensures correct functioning of the door and allows area for the tracks on both aspect.


Is there a minimal clearance needed for the garage door opener?undefinedYes, you will want about 2-3 inches of clearance between the top of the garage door and the opener's mounting point. This space is essential for original site the opener's operation and sometimes varies relying on the model.


What depth space do I want within the garage for the door?undefinedYou should have a minimum depth of 24 inches from the door opening to the again wall of the garage. This house is essential for the door to completely open and permits for any essential equipment like the opener or storage.


Does the type of garage door have an effect on room requirements?undefinedYes, different varieties of garage doorways (sectional, roll-up, etc.) have varying room requirements. Sectional doors sometimes want extra headroom and track house, whereas roll-up doors could require less space but can necessitate more wall clearance.
